Town & Country V6-4.0L (2008)
Brake Pad: Removal and Replacement
Front
REMOVAL
NOTE: Before proceeding, See: Service Precautions/Brakes - Caution.
1. Raise and support the vehicle.See: Maintenance/Vehicle Lifting/Service and Repair
NOTE: Perform STEP 2 through STEP 5 on each side of the vehicle to complete pad set removal.
2. Remove the wheel mounting nuts (3), then the tire and wheel assembly (1).
CAUTION: When removing or installing a caliper guide pin bolt, it is necessary to hold the guide pin stationary while turning the bolt. Hold
the guide pin stationary using a wrench placed upon the pin's hex-shaped head.
3. Remove the two brake caliper guide pin bolts (2, 3).
4. Remove the disc brake caliper (4) from the disc brake adapter bracket (1) and hang it out of the way using wire or a bungee cord. Use care not to
overextend the brake hose when doing this.
